Watch Home Alone on Disney+

Home Alone, Home Alone 2: Lost in New York and Home Alone 3 are all streaming on Disney+ for anyone with a subscription plan. You can also watch the latest film, Home Sweet Home Alone on Disney+ as well. Basic plans start at $7.99 for a monthly subscription, and yearly for $79.99.

Once you’re signed up, you can stream the Home Alone series online as well as everything from Marvel to Pixar films, and even new releases like Peter Jackson’s eight-part Beatles documentary, Get Back.

Watch Home Alone on Amazon Prime

Amazon Prime Video, Apple TV and More: Home Alone 4: Taking Back the House can be streamed with your Apple TV or by renting it on Google Play. The 2013 release Home Alone: Holiday Heist, along with the original Home Alone films in the meantime, are available to rent on Amazon Prime Video.

How to Stream Home Sweet Home Alone on Disney+

The latest reboot in the Home Alone series, Home Sweet Home Alone, is streaming on Disney+ right now. The Dan Mazer-directed movie stars Archie Yates, Rob Delaney and Devin Ratray, who played Buzz McAllister in the original film. The only way you can watch the film right now is with a Disney+ subscription or bundle plan.
